  • Windsor Castle

The day starts with a visit to the famous Windsor Castle, plunging you into the history of the British Royal family. The residence of Elizabeth II is known as one of the oldest and grandest castles in the world; its spectacular bedrooms and luxurious furnishings are captivating. You will also visit St George’s Chapel where you will find the tombs of numerous Kings including Henry VII, and have the chance to marvel at Queen Mary's famous dolls house.

  • Stonehenge

After Windsor, your tour will take you to the mythical site of Stonehenge, classed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Built some 5,000 years ago, this monument has captivated humanity for centuries, inspiring numerous theories about its original purpose, which still remains a mystery. Was it a religious temple? An astrological clock? Or maybe a Bronze-Age cemetery? You can forge your own opinion during your visit!

  • Bath

Lastly, you will head to another UNESCO World Heritage Site: the City of Bath. In this historic city you will discover the magnificent 15th-century Abbey and fall under the charm of the typical Georgian architecture.

Depending on your option chosen, visit the world-famous Roman Baths to admire the splendid pools and monuments which were miraculously preserved from discovery until 1870 and are now considered as architectural gems.
